Congressional Gold Medal for North Platte Canteen: Honoring WWII Volunteers

This act awards a Congressional Gold Medal to the individuals and communities who volunteered or donated to the North Platte Canteen during World War II. This symbolic recognition aims to commemorate their immense contribution to troop morale and the war effort, highlighting the importance of volunteerism and community unity during challenging times.
Key points
Establishes a Congressional Gold Medal for North Platte Canteen volunteers and donors, honoring their service during World War II.
The medal will be given to the Lincoln County Historical Museum in North Platte, Nebraska, for public display and research.
Authorizes the sale of bronze duplicates of the medal, with proceeds supporting the Mint's fund to cover production costs.
